What Is a Casino Bonus and How Does It Actually Work
A casino bonus is essentially free money or spins offered by an online casino to attract or retain players. It works by crediting your account with a bonus amount after meeting a specific deposit condition, but you cannot instantly withdraw it. The method behind the bonus is the wagering requirement: you must bet the bonus amount (plus sometimes the deposit) a set number of times before any winnings become cashable. For example, a 100% match bonus up to $200 means you deposit $200 and get $200 extra, but with a 40x playthrough, you must wager $8,000 before withdrawing. Q: How does a casino bonus actually transfer to real money? A: Only after you complete the exact wagering requirements—any attempt to withdraw early voids the bonus and winnings. Always check the game contribution percentages, as slots usually count 100% while table games count far less.
Breaking Down the Core Mechanics of Match Deposits and Free Spins
A match deposit bonus multiplies your qualifying deposit by a set percentage (e.g., a 100% match doubles your funds) up to a cap, with those bonus credits typically added to a separate balance. Free spins are allocated in fixed batches, often tied to specific slot titles, and their value is predetermined (e.g., 20 spins at $0.10 each). Both mechanics rely on wagering requirements—a multiplier applied to the bonus amount or winnings from spins—before withdrawal is allowed. Stakes from bonus funds may have game-specific contribution rates, and free spin winnings are frequently capped. Q: How does a match deposit percentage affect my effective bonus value? A: A higher percentage (e.g., 200% vs. 100%) increases your bonus funds relative to your deposit, but always check the maximum cap and wagering terms to gauge true value.
Understanding Wagering Requirements and Why They Matter
Wagering requirements dictate how many times you must play through a bonus amount before withdrawing winnings. A 30x requirement on a $100 bonus means placing $3,000 in bets. This directly impacts real value, as high requirements make bonuses less profitable. To calculate effective value, multiply the bonus by the wagering multiplier and factor in game contribution percentages—slots typically count 100%, while table games may count only 10%. Understanding wagering requirements and why they matter prevents unexpected losses. Follow this sequence:
- Identify the wagering multiplier (e.g., 35x).
- Multiply it by the bonus amount.
- Check game contribution rates.
- Estimate realistic completion time.

No-Deposit Bonuses vs. Deposit Matches—Which Gives You More
When comparing no-deposit bonuses versus deposit matches, the key trade-off is risk versus reward. A no-deposit bonus gives you free play money or spins without any financial commitment, allowing you to test a casino risk-free, but the amounts are usually small (e.g., $10–$20) with high wagering requirements. In contrast, a deposit match multiplies your own money, often at 100% or more, providing a much larger bankroll to extend playtime. However, you must fund your account to trigger it. Ultimately, deposit matches give you more total value, but no-deposit bonuses offer a zero-risk starting point.
- No-deposit bonuses offer risk-free exploration but limited funds.
- Deposit matches provide significantly larger playtime for a funded account.
- Wagering requirements are often steeper on no-deposit offers.
Cashback, Reload Offers, and Loyalty Points Explained Simply
Cashback feels like a safety net, refunding a percentage of your net losses over a set period. Reload offers are smaller deposit match bonuses for your second, third, or weekend deposits, giving your balance a regular boost. Loyalty points are earned simply by playing any game, and these points can usually be exchanged for bonus cash or free spins. Together, these rewards create sustained playtime value without requiring a massive upfront deposit. Stacking a reload offer with daily cashback and active point accumulation is the easiest way to stretch your bankroll session after session.

Can You Withdraw Bonus Money Right Away and What Limits Apply
No, you cannot withdraw bonus money right away. Casinos impose strict wagering requirements that must be met before any bonus funds become withdrawable. These requirements specify a multiplier—often 30x to 50x—applied to the bonus amount (or bonus plus deposit) that you must wager first. Additionally, time limits (e.g., 7–30 days) cap how long you have to complete the playthrough, and maximum bet limits (typically $5–$10 per spin) apply while wagering. Ignoring these caps forfeits the bonus and any associated winnings.
You cannot withdraw bonus money right away; you must meet wagering requirements, time limits, and bet caps first.
What Happens to Winnings When You Trigger a Promotion
When you trigger a promotion, winnings from bonus funds are typically credited as bonus balance rather than cash. This balance is subject to wagering requirements before withdrawal. For example, a $20 bonus win might require 35x playthrough ($700 in bets) to convert to withdrawable cash. Any winnings earned during the wagering process remain frozen in the bonus balance until the playthrough is satisfied. If you forfeit the bonus early, those winnings are usually lost entirely.
Winnings from a triggered promotion are locked into a bonus balance and are only withdrawable after meeting the associated wagering requirements.
